EC 1.1.1.62: 17-beta-estradiol 17-dehydrogenase

Reaction catalysed:
17-beta-estradiol + NAD(P)(+) = estrone + NAD(P)H
Systematic name:
17-beta-estradiol:NAD(P)(+) 17-oxidoreductase

EC 1.1.1.105: All-trans-retinol dehydrogenase (NAD(+))

Reaction catalysed:
All-trans-retinol-[cellular-retinol-binding-protein] + NAD(+) = all-trans-retinal-[cellular-retinol-binding-protein] + NADH
Systematic name:
All-trans retinol:NAD(+) oxidoreductase
